Misconceptions About Roofing Materials



When it concerns roof products, you've most likely came across numerous mistaken beliefs that can result in inadequate choices. One common misconception is that all roofing products are similarly durable. In truth, various materials have differing lifespans and resistance to weather conditions. For example, asphalt roof shingles may be budget-friendly, however they typically require more regular replacements compared to metal or floor tile roofing systems.

An additional false impression is that lighter-colored roof materials are constantly much better for power efficiency. While lighter hues mirror sunshine, factors like insulation and air flow likewise play critical functions in preserving energy efficiency.

You may additionally assume that a greater price warranties better high quality. However, some costly products may not appropriate for your details climate or roofing framework. It's necessary to review the efficiency characteristics rather than simply the cost.

Finally, several believe that all roofing materials are ecologically harmful. In reality, options like steel and specific kinds of roof shingles can be reused, supplying a greener option.

Life Expectancy and Substitute Myths



Despite what you could hear, the lifespan of your roof typically varies considerably based upon the products utilized and regional climate conditions. Many property owners believe that all roof coverings last the same quantity of time, but that's much from the fact.

As an example, asphalt shingles commonly last 15 to thirty years, while metal roofings can last 40 to 70 years. If you live in a location with extreme climate, your roof covering might need replacement earlier than anticipated.
